6.3.3.
Other
Features
Specific
to
the
Type
4815
The
construction
of
the
Type
4815
is
sim
ilar
to
that
of
the
Type
4814
in
that
the
force
produced
in
the
Driver
Coil is
directed
to
a
single
mounting
point
in
the
center,
the
upper
radial
flexure
is
one
piece
and
the
Driver
Coil is
formed
of
aluminum
wire.
However,
the
total
peak-to-peak
travel
is
only
12,7
mm
(0,5
in).
Magnetic
shields
are
provided
to
reduce
the
flux
density
above
the
table
top
.
Figs.6.14
and
6.15
are
plots
of
typical
steady
state
flux
density
as a
function
of
distance
above
the
table
top.
The
alternating
flux
density
is
negligible.
